Hazardous or Technical Waste legislation...

Management of hazardous waste is one of the most highly regulated activities in the UK. Correct classification, packing and labeling is essential. Many sites producing hazardous waste must also be registered and detailed transport documentation (consignment notes) must be produced for every load. Strict regulations also determine the disposal methods to be employed.

Each of the following items of waste disposal legislation contains provisions relating to the management of hazardous or technical waste:

  • The Hazardous Waste (England and Wales) Regulations 2005
  • The Hazardous Waste (England and Wales) (Amendment) Regulations 2009
  • Environmental Permitting (England and Wales) Regulations 2010
  • The Waste (England and Wales) Regulations 2011
  • The List of Wastes (England) Regulations 2005
  • The List of Wastes (England) (Amendment) Regulations 2005
  • The Carriage of Dangerous Goods and Use of Transportable Pressure Equipment Regulations 2004
  • The Carriage of Dangerous Goods and Use of Transportable Pressure Equipment Regulations (Amendment) 2011
  • The Control of Pollution Act 1974
  • The Environmental Protection Act 1990
  • The Environmental Protection (Duty of Care) Regulations 1991
  • The Environmental Protection (Duty of Care) (England) (Amendment) Regulations 2003
  • Pollution Prevention and Control (England and Wales) (Amendment) Regulations 2007
  • The Pollution Prevention and Control (Designation of Directives) (England and Wales) Order 2011
  • The Waste Incineration (England and Wales) Regulations 2002
  • The Transfrontier Shipment of Waste Regulations 2007
  • The Transfrontier Shipment of Waste (Amendment) Regulations 2008
  • The Transfrontier Shipment of Radioactive Waste and Spent Fuel Regulations 2008
  • The Animal By-Products Regulations 2005
  • The Animal By-Products (Enforcement) and Transmissible Spongiform Encephalopathies (England) (Amendment) Regulations 2011
  • The Control of Substances Hazardous to Health Regulations 2002
  • The Control of Substances Hazardous to Health (Amendment) Regulations 2004
  • The Environmental Protection (Controls on Ozone-Depleting Substances) Regulations 2011
